Henzie "Toolbox" Torre

Mythique Anglais Johannes Voss
TypeLegendary Creature — Devil Rogue
Couleurs
Identité couleur
Mana
Valeur3.00
Force / Endurance3 / 3
Texte impriméEach creature spell you cast with mana value 4 or greater has blitz. The blitz cost is equal to its mana cost. (You may choose to cast that spell for its blitz cost. If you do, it gains haste and "When this creature dies, draw a card." Sacrifice it at the beginning of the next end step.)
Blitz costs you pay cost less for each time you've cast your commander from the command zone this game.

Notes et règles informationsNotes et rulings officiels récupérés depuis Scryfall.
1

If the back face of a modal double-faced card is a creature with mana value 4 or greater, you may cast it using the blitz ability granted by Henzie.

2

If you choose to pay the blitz cost rather than the mana cost, you're still casting the spell. It goes on the stack and can be responded to and countered. You can cast a creature spell for its blitz cost only if you could cast that creature spell. Most of the time, this means during your main phase when the stack is empty.

3

If you pay the blitz cost to cast a creature spell, that permanent will be sacrificed only if it's still on the battlefield when that triggered ability resolves. If it dies or goes to another zone before then, it will stay where it is.

4

You don't have to attack with the creature with blitz unless another ability says you do.

5

If a creature enters the battlefield as a copy of or becomes a copy of a creature whose blitz cost was paid, the copy won't have haste, won't be sacrificed, and its controller won't draw a card when it dies.

6

The triggered ability that lets its controller draw a card triggers when it dies for any reason, not just when you sacrifice it during the end step.
